Washington Cotes

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Washington Cotes was Dean of Lismore from 1747 until[1] 1762;[2] and Provost of Tuam from 1858 to 1862.[3]

He was educated at Trinity College, Dublin. His wife was born in 1722 and died in 1790.[4]
